Isomers are defined as compounds with the same chemical formula but different structures. For the examples, butane (\(C_4H_{10}\)) and isobutane (\(C_4H_{10}\)) fit the isomer definition as they have the same formula but different structures. Methane (\(CH_4\)) and butane (\(C_4H_{10}\)) have different formulas. Ethane (\(C_2H_6\)) and propene (\(C_3H_6\)) also have different formulas.
